List six different enzymes associated with the replication process mastering biology

DNA helicase - unwinds and separates double stranded DNA as it moves along the DNA. It forms the replication fork by breaking hydrogen bonds between nucleotide pairs in DNA.

DNA primase - a type of RNA polymerase that generates RNA primers. Primers are short RNA molecules that act as templates for the starting point of DNA replication.

DNA polymerases - synthesize new DNA molecules by adding nucleotides to leading and lagging DNA strands.

Topoisomerase or DNA Gyrase - unwinds and rewinds DNA strands to prevent the DNA from becoming tangled or supercoiled.

Exonucleases - group of enzymes that remove nucleotide bases from the end of a DNA chain.

DNA ligase - joins DNA fragments together by forming phosphodiester bonds between nucleotides.

Given the parents AABBCc × AabbCc, assume simple dominance for each trait and independent assortment. What proportion of the pro
Anit [1.1K]

Answer:

3/4

Explanation:

If we assume simple dominance and independent assortment for each trait, we can use Mendel's Law of Segregation to predict the phenotypic proportions in the offspring of the parental cross AABBCc x AabbCc.

<h3><u>Gene A</u></h3>

AA x Aa

  • F1 genotypes: 1/2 AA, 1/2 Aa
  • F1 phenotypes: all A
<h3 /><h3><u>Gene B</u></h3>

BB x bb

  • F1 genotypes: 1 Bb
  • F1 phenotypes: all B
<h3 /><h3><u>Gene C</u></h3>

Cc x Cc

  • F1 genotypes:  1/4 CC, 2/4 Cc, 1/4 cc
  • F1 phenotypes: 3/4 C, 1/4 cc

We want to know the proportion of progeny with all dominant phenotype (A_B_C_). Since the genes are independent, we can multiply the probabilities of each gene to obtain the overall probability of having a ABC progeny:

<h3>1 A_ x 1 B_ x 3/4 C_ = 3/4 A_B_C_</h3>

Before the forming urine flows into the distal tubule of the nephron, it is in the _____ ______ _____, where water is absorbed a
liraira [26]

Answer:

<em>"Before the forming urine flows into the distal tubule of the nephron, it is in the </em><em>loop of Henle</em><em>, where water is absorbed as the fluid descends into the deep medulla of the kidney, and salts are absorbed as the fluid flows back up to the cortex of the kidney".</em>

Explanation:

Henle´s loop is a specific section of renal tubules that forms the nephrons.

In this U-shaped region, the two parts of the contorted tubule, the distal and the proximal part, are very close to each other. In the kidney, both parts of the tubules are located in the renal cortex, while the loop of Henle is located within the renal medulla.

The proximal region of the Henle´s loop is a permeable region, unlike the proximal and distal regions of the renal tubule.  

This is why it is possible the interchange of water and ions in the Henle´s loop. In the loop´s walls, cells present aquaporines in their membranes that allow passive water absorption, while they do not allow the transport of ions and urea. In this way 25% of the water that passes through the kidney might be filtered.  

The ascendant side of the loop, which is narrower, the tubule wall is impermeable to water but allows the ions´reabsorption. Here, cells present sodium, potassium, and chloride channels.

Potassium sodium pump transporters are found in the basolateral zone. While in the apical area are active transporters of the 3 ions.

Due to these differences in the water and ions´absorption between the two parts of the Henle´s loop, a countercurrent multiplier effect is produced, stratifying the osmotic compounds of the medullary interstitium, being the part closest to the cortex less concentrated than the part closest to the renal papilla, which is about 4 times more concentrated in ions.

Which process is the first step of protein synthesis
svp [43]
The first step in protein synthesis is the transcription of mRNA from a DNA gene in the nucleus. At some other prior time, the various other types of RNA have been synthesized using the appropriate DNA. The RNAs migrate from the nucleus into the cytoplasm.
